Fished the Bell today 120ft to 190ft caught three under sized one right on the line at 60cm. Then lost a nice one at the boat due to my bad net job, it was defiantly a keeper. All on white hoochies and a green lemon lime flasher, right off the bottom. 7 crabs in three traps all under sized.

It was pretty slow at Grace, until it wasn’t. Ended up with 3 keepers and one was a nice chunky 74cm. Was north of the pack in 160’ water and it paid off. 205 on rigger. One on a Wee G spoon and 2 on the cream soda flasher and glow white hooch. Couple unders released too. Beauty end to the year See ya on the 2024 thread View attachment 101243

Good action around the mile markers. Four unders so far in less than an hour. A bit lumpy but laying down now. 130-160 contours.
I fished right where that photo was taken. We didn't see much bait until the first mile marker, then a ton of bait and action at that particular freighter. It was nonstop with over a dozen to the boat a couple 60s and a bunch around 50s. It was fun times.
 
Another great day off grace. Took awhile but we got 3. Running the 5” 602 on bottom. Seems to keep the smalls off and the large on.
